Abstract

A composite type thin-film magnetic head is provided, which comprises: a MR read head element having an upper shield layer, a lower shield layer, an MR layer in which a sense current flows in a direction perpendicular to a surface of the layer through the upper shield layer and the lower shield layer; an inductive write head element formed on the MR read head element, having an upper magnetic pole layer, a recording gap layer, a lower magnetic pole layer where end portion is opposed to an end portion of the upper magnetic pole layer through the recording gap layer, and a write coil; and a capacitance C12 between the write coil and the upper shield layer, set to 0.1 pF or less.
